A local favorite, River Horse Brewing Company has grown into one of New Jersey’s premier craft breweries. I have had the pleasure of visiting this brewery on multiple occasions, and though I do miss the old location in the charming town of Lambertville, the new production facility allows for a better overall brewery visit. Not to mention all of the additional beer they can make!
ABV: 8.0 %
Pour: Amber/Mahogany, slightly cloudy.
Head: Thick Ivory/Cream color.
Nose: Very sweet, with a mix of fruit and caramel notes. Apple. Maybe candy apple?
Palate: Malty with prominent notes of caramel, cookie dough. Lots of rich flavors here.
Finish: Hop notes come through here, with a slight bitterness, but well balanced with more rich, malty flavors. Milk duds, toast, a hint of cough syrup.
Overall: A very nice pour. I remember liking this even more when I had it at the brewery, but this one gets a solid rating from me.
